A FATHER and his 14-year-old son have been found guilty of murdering a man in a Barking pub.

Harry Farrant and his dad Jason Michael, 39, knifed Daniel Leahy after starting a bar brawl on April 13 this year.

They left the knife embedded in the chest of the 45-year-old, who bled to death on the floor of The Victoria pub, in Axe Street.

The pair will be sentenced on November 27.
